Mike Webb, Seaton Beach managing director, says of the awards, “To be recognised by our industry peers for our Passivhaus apartment block is a great honour.  Not many UK developers build to this standard from Germany now over 30 years old and globally recognised. We could have taken the traditional route, however we believed it was the right way forward for the environment. Our new owners will experience extremely low bills with very high comfort levels.” Mike, who re trained as a certified Passivhaus consultant, plans to help other self-builders and developers achieve this standard too, offering a unique “try before you build” consultancy service. Alex Alsop from Norrsken, the company which supplied and installed the high performance tripled glazed windows and sliding doors, adds, “We’re very proud to be part of this project and deliver practicality and comfort to the homeowners.
